A little backstory: My wife and I just came off our 5th VV sailing and prior to this, we were ready to take a break from VV due to the same old entertainment options and vibe. However, this past Med cruise was the most epic VV voyage we have sailed, and we already booked another Med for next year. Full disclosure, I am an Idol in the casino so we get comp cruises which makes it a little easier to rebook so fast, but I think VV has hit its groove.

 

Entertainment: One of my biggest complaints was the happenings cast interrupting the vibe in the club and at the pj party, but they have backed off somewhat and are more focused on making the vibe even better rather than performing their choreographed dance routine. My second biggest complaint was that they would kill the music at the Scarlet pool party even though people were still dancing and getting after it. Yes, there is an afterparty, but keep the music going where it is and then kill it once people move to Manor. This trip, they kept the beats going until 1230-1245 am before shutting it off at the pool. And, on the scarlet night - holy smokes was it epic. I heard several other VV frequent cruisers saying it was the best scarlet night they have attended, and I agree. It was off the charts awesome.

Lastly, VV has added more shows, to include a rock band show which is full of 90's and 2000's hits and its a fun time. Also, they had several other musicians who were very talented. Overall, entertainment has improved greatly.

 

People: I feel like word has gotten out about what to expect on a VV. Its not your typical Celebrity or RC or Princess cruise...def more upscale than Carnival. But, I didn't hear one person complaining on this cruise; Rather, everyone was praising VV and their business model. On prior cruises, I heard people saying there is nothing to do, its too loud, the food is bland (lies), etc. I think people on this cruise knew what to expect and, as such, the cruise met their expectations. 

Most people were 35-55, with about 15% under 35 and 20% or so over 55. I saw one couple who had to be 75+ getting after it on the dance floor. Amazing.

 

Anyway, just wanted to let any prior sailors know that VV has switched it up and made the experience even better. Def will keep sailing VV.

I have worked in the casino industry now for 25 years. The coin in requirements for the cruise lines is crazy high compared to most land based casinos. When you look at your table games it is usually based on buy in amount, time played and in some instance they will factor in amounts bet. There is nothing free in a casino except water. Even table games players are spending more then what it would normally cost outright to pay for a room or buy a meal. My feelings are if you enjoy the excitement of gambling, have fun and take what ever they are willing to give you.
